Git Bash 教程:从入门到精通

作者:热心市民鹿先生2024.01.17 23:20浏览量:6

简介:本文将为你介绍如何使用 Git Bash 进行版本控制和代码管理,涵盖了下载项目、提交变更以及从服务器获取更新的详细步骤。通过学习本教程,你将能够熟练掌握 Git Bash 的基本操作,提高你的代码管理效率。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

Git Bash 是 Git 的命令行工具,它提供了丰富的功能和命令来帮助开发者进行版本控制和代码管理。通过 Git Bash,你可以轻松地下载项目、提交变更以及从服务器获取更新。本教程将带你了解如何使用 Git Bash 进行这些操作。
一、Git Bash 下载项目
在开始使用 Git Bash 之前,你需要先创建一个本地文件夹作为 Git 的本地仓库存储位置。然后,你可以通过以下步骤在 Git Bash 中下载项目:

  1. 打开 Git Bash,进入你创建的本地文件夹。
  2. 复制项目的 SSH 链接。
  3. 在 Git Bash 中输入 git clone [项目 SSH 链接] 来下载项目。如果你提前配置了 SSH 免密登录,则不需要输入用户名和密码。
  4. 等待项目下载完成,此时你可以在本地文件夹下看到刚下载的项目文件。
    二、Git Bash 提交变更(增改删)
    在 Git Bash 中,你可以通过以下步骤提交变更:
  5. 新建文件:在本地创建一个新文件,例如 test.txt 并写入一些内容。
  6. 查看变更:进入到 .git 文件夹所在的路径后输入 git status 查看当前 Git 状态。你会发现 test.txt 文件处于一个不可识别状态。
  7. 将新文件添加到暂存区:使用 git add 指令让 Git 客户端接受这个文件。这样,test.txt 就变成了新增文件。
  8. 提交变更:使用 git commit 指令提交本地变更。在提交时输入相应的备注信息,以便于日后查看和管理。
  9. 推送变更:使用 git push 指令将本地仓库的变更推送到远程 Git 仓库。这样,服务器端也会有你刚刚提交的 test.txt 文件了。
    除了新建文件,你还可以修改现有文件或删除文件。不过要注意的是,默认情况下删除文件并不会被提交,以避免误删除。如果你想记录删除操作,可以使用 git add <file_name> 将删除的文件添加到暂存区,然后提交变更并推送更新。
    三、从服务器获取更新
    当你需要从服务器获取更新时,可以使用以下步骤:
  10. 在 Git Bash 中输入 git fetch -all 从远程仓库获取全部文件的引用对象。这样你就可以查看服务器端的最新提交信息了。
  11. 如果服务器端有新的提交,你可以使用 git pull 指令将服务器端的更新拉取到本地仓库。这样你就可以获取最新的代码和变更了。
    通过以上步骤,你应该已经掌握了 Git Bash 的基本操作。在实际使用中,你还需要不断熟悉和掌握更多的 Git 命令和用法,以便更好地进行版本控制和代码管理。同时,建议查阅官方文档或相关教程来深入学习 Git 的高级功能和最佳实践。
article bottom image

相关文章推荐

发表评论